About Xuecheng Zhang

Xuecheng Zhang is a scholar working on Biotechnology,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ment and Oceanography, having authored 197 papers that have together received 4.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Algal biology and biofuel production (21 papers), Enzyme Production and Characterization (18 papers), Enzyme-mediated dye degradation (10 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(9 papers), Marine and coastal plant biology (9 papers),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(9 papers), Ubiquitin and proteasome pathways (8 papers) and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biotechnology (484 citations), Plant Science (1.7k citations) and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(387 citations). Xuecheng Zhang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Gary Stacey, Yazhong Xiao, Jinrong Wan, Wei Fang, Walter Gassmann, Steven B. Cannon, Zemin Fang, Xiaoming Tu, Jiahai Zhang and Hui Peng.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Renewable and Sustainable Energy Reviews and PLoS ONE.
